ePrint Report: Weak Fiat-Shamir Attacks on Modern Proof Systems

Quang Dao, Jim Miller, Opal Wright, Paul Grubbs


A flurry of excitement amongst researchers and practitioners has produced modern proof systems built using novel technical ideas and seeing rapid deployment, especially in cryptocurrencies. Most of these modern proof systems use the Fiat-Shamir (F-S) transformation, a seminal method of removing interaction from a protocol with a public-coin verifier.
